Proff IM Solutions Inc

900-275 Slater St, Ottawa, ON K1P 5H9
613-234-5639

Proff IM Solutions Inc - 900-275 Slater St, Ottawa, ON

Situated at 900-275 Slater St in Ottawa, Ontario, Proff IM Solutions Inc is a merchant in the training software section of Canpages.ca online directory.

Phone 613-234-5639 to contact Proff IM Solutions Inc that is close to your area.

Finally, please share this with your contacts by clicking Facebook or Twitter icons.